#7db4db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7db4db is composed of 49% red, 70.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 204.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 67.5%. #7db4db color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#0069b7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#7db4db color description : Very soft blue.
#7db4db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7db4db has RGB values of R:125, G:180,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 8238299.

Shades and Tints of #7db4db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020608 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7db4db
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aacae is the less saturated color, while #5db9fb is the most saturated one.
